Development and Use of Definite Plan. Upon an Affirmative Determination and the States’ Concurrence pursuant to Section 3.3.5, the DRE shall develop a Definite Plan for Facilities Removal to include it as a part of any applications for permits or other authorizations. The Definite Plan shall be consistent with this Settlement, the Authorizing Legislation, the Detailed Plan, and the Secretarial Determination.
